Among other things, here's what you'll be doing:
- Lead and coordinate with consultants, internal teams, and external partners to ensure the successful execution of healthcare architecture projects, from concept to completion.
- Provide leadership in translating project visions into actionable design plans, ensuring they meet healthcare-specific requirements, codes, and regulations.
- Conduct research and develop specialized details to solve unique design challenges specific to healthcare environments, such as patient flow, safety, and accessibility.
- Analyze building codes and healthcare-specific regulations to ensure compliance, oversee submittal reviews, and lead the response process for construction RFIs, ensuring timely resolution of technical issues.
- Strengthen project management skills, with an emphasis on delivering high-quality healthcare projects and cultivating strong client relationships for future opportunities.
Ideal qualifications we seek in a candidate:
- Bachelor’s degree or higher in architecture, with at least 5 years of professional experience in healthcare architecture or related fields.
- Strong interest in Behavioral health design and healing environments.
- Licensed Architect.
- Proficient in Revit, with a strong understanding of using the tool to support project management, collaboration, and design needs.
- Leadership and project management skills, with the ability to manage multiple projects and ensure their successful outcomes.
- LEED accredited or strong interest in sustainability
